Here’s where it gets real: The technical differences in detail

Model 3

Costs and Efficiency:

When it comes to price and running costs, the biggest differences usually appear. This is often where you see which car fits your budget better in the long run.

MG MG4 Urban is considerably cheaper – starting at 21,400 £ , while the Tesla Model 3 costs 31,700 £ . That’s a price difference of around 10,285 £.

In terms of energy consumption, the Tesla Model 3 is a bit more efficient: consuming 13 kWh/100km compared to 15.3 kWh/100km for the MG MG4 Urban. That’s a difference of about 2.3 kWh/100km.

As for electric range, the Tesla Model 3 offers considerably more range – reaching up to 750 km, about 334 km more than the MG MG4 Urban.

Engine and Performance:

Power, torque and acceleration say a lot about how a car feels on the road. This is where you see which model delivers more driving dynamics.

When it comes to engine power, the Tesla Model 3 offers substantially more power – delivering 460 HP compared to 160 HP. That’s roughly 300 HP more horsepower.

When accelerating from 0 to 100 km/h, the Tesla Model 3 is considerably quicker – completing the sprint in 3.1 s, while the MG MG4 Urban takes 9.5 s. That’s about 6.4 s quicker.

There’s also a difference in torque: the Tesla Model 3 delivers clearly more torque with 660 Nm compared to 250 Nm. That’s about 410 Nm more.

Space and Everyday Use:

Whether family car or daily driver – which one offers more room, flexibility and comfort?

Both vehicles offer seating for 5 people.

In terms of curb weight, MG MG4 Urban is visibly lighter – 1,460 kg compared to 1,822 kg. The difference is around 362 kg.

Looking at boot space, the Tesla Model 3 offers slightly more boot space – 594 L compared to 479 L. That’s a difference of about 115 L.

When it comes to payload, the MG MG4 Urban carries clearly more – 450 kg compared to 333 kg. That’s a difference of about 117 kg.

Tesla Model 3

The Tesla Model 3 is a compact electric sedan that pairs brisk, responsive driving with a sleek, minimalist cabin and intuitive, software-led features. It makes a practical, modern choice for daily commutes and long-term ownership while emphasizing simplicity and advanced driver assistance.

MG MG4 Urban

The MG4 Urban is an affordable, well‑packaged electric hatchback that balances everyday practicality with a surprisingly roomy cabin and confident handling. It’s a smart choice if you want an easy-to-live-with EV that focuses on value and usable range rather than luxury frills.
